The program of the North Ameri
can Conservation Conference which
opens in Washington tomorrow, has
teen completed and the vain-features j
M' it have just been made public. The
President will receive .the Canadian
and Mexican Commissioners at 10 o'
clock tomorrow morning in the East
Room of the White House. The mem
bers of the Cabinet and of the Na
tional Conservation Commission will
be present. The Canadians and Mex
icans will be presented to the Pres
ident by Secretary of State Bacon:
This session will be wholly Informal
and brief. At Its conclusion, the Con
ferees will proceed to the Diplomatic
Room of the State Department, where
the regular sessions will be held. It
is probable that the remainder of the
morning will be taken up with formal
addresses of welcome and responses
of the visitors. In the afternoon the
Conference will take up its work in
earnest. It is expected that the ses
sions will -continue the remainder of
the week.
The evenings of the foreign dele
gates will be very fully occupied with
various social functions that have
been arranged by their compatriots
and government officers in Washing
ton. The personnel of the delegations
from Canada and Mexico guarantee
the accomplishment of real results
from the Conference, for all the mem
bers are experts in the natural re
sources of their countries.
Canada will be represented by the
Honorable Sydney Fisher, Minister of
Agriculture of the Dominion, the Hon
orable Clifford Slfton, Ex-Minister of
the Interior, under whose adminis
tration many of the regulations con
cerning the use of Canada's resources
were adopted, and Dr. Henri S. Be
land, a member of the Canadian par
liament, who is a well-known author
ity on these subjects. The rcjm
delegation will also., be accompanied
by-. Rooert E. Young, land expert in
the Canadian Department of the In
terior, who will act as its Secretary.
Tc represent Mexico, President DIas
has sent Romulo Escobar, Manuel A.
De , Quevedo, and. Carlos Sollerier 8e-
nor Escobar,-who heads the delega
tion, is one' Ot the foremost author!
ties in Mexico on the agriculture of

DEAD IN PLUNGE OF TRAIN.
One KiUed, Six Hart, in Wreck el
High Trestle..
By Wire to The Sun.
Baton Rouge, La. Feb 17. A freight
train on the Louinianian Railway ftl
Navigation Company's line was wreck
ed near here today, plunging over a
trestle 35 feet high, killing one and
During six, four om them perhaps fa
